A design pattern is the reusable form of a solution to a design problem. The dasii scoring assistant scores and generates a variety of reports on your computer. Pattern design system alternatives and similar software. Pattern grading is often associated with complicated calculations and laborious work in order to scale a pattern into different sizes telestia creator pattern grading cad software introduces a unique system of grading patterns, that has simplified this process for you in a miraculous way by removing all the hard work yet leaving you in control. It is not a finished design that can be transformed directly into source or machine code. Pdf investigating the theoretical structure of the dasii core. The dasii early years and schoolage batteries were normed for. The existing automatic techniques for design pattern s.
How important are design patterns in software development. In software engineering, a software design pattern is a general, reusable solution to a commonly occurring problem within a given context in software design. Numerous software design patterns have been introduced and cataloged either as a canonical or a variant solution to solve a design problem. The strategy pattern defines a family of algorithms, encapsulate each one, and make them interchangeable. The existing automatic techniques for design patterns. Pattern grading is often associated with complicated calculations and laborious work in order to scale a pattern into different sizes.
Wild ginger software regular retail prices are listed below. It is not a process in which preformed parts are combined to create a whole. However, most of the software should treat a box holding several items just like a single item. The idea was introduced by the architect christopher alexander and has been adapted for various other disciplines, notably software engineering. Aug 28, 2014 design patterns provide a highlevel language of discourse for programmers to describe their systems and to discuss solutions to common problems. There are three primary groups of people the software can help. Dasii differential ability scalesii pearson assessments. Home sewers who want to modify a design to fit customers products. The idea was introduced by the architect christopher alexander and has been adapted for.
Factor structure of the differential ability scalessecond edition. Please note that the software is compatible with windows xp. For set b and c, the child constructed a design by putting together flat squares or solid. Joinpattern provides a way to write concurrent, parallel and distributed programs by message passing. Wild ginger software offers a variety of software products for sewing and craft enthusiasts, custom dressmakers and tailors, and theatrical costumers. Realtime software architectures and design patterns. Block building subtest is combined with the pattern construction subtest look.
An architectural pattern is a general, reusable solution to a commonly occurring problem in software architecture within a given context. Description of cognitive subtests wj iv dasii kabcii. Strategy lets the algorithm vary independently from clients that use it. Differential ability scalesii dasii pearson clinical. Pattern construction pcon visualperceptual matching,especially of spatial orientation, in copying block patterns. A pattern is a named nugget of instructive information that captures the essential structure and insight of a. Elliott, 1990a is an individually administered battery of cognitive and achievement tests for children and adolescents aged 2 years, 6 months through 17 years, 11 months. Overview of the differential ability scalessecond edition gloria maccow, ph. Patternmaker is software for windows that helps you design clothing. Elements of reusable objectoriented software, published in 1995, has sold hundreds of thousands of copies to date, and is largely considered one of the foremost authorities on objectoriented theory and software development practices. On the pattern construction subtest, for set a, the child copie two d or threedimensional design with wooden blocks. Dec 26, 2017 pattern design system sometimes referred to as pds was added by openuser in jan 2011 and the latest update was made in nov 2014. An investigation of the pattern of subtest loadings was informative. Software requirement patterns stephen withall page i thursday, may 10, 2007 12.
A set of alternative instructions for the pattern construction subtest were. Software requirement patterns developer best practices. To understand software architecture, or simply architecture, let us discuss a requirement of real life. Lecture introduction to software engineering module in0006, as listed in module description for slide downloads and discussion regarding class, use the pse moodle course. I worked in a system which included a versioning system to migrate a db to the latest version, and it worked like that. Software patterns ii software patterns sigs management briefings present cuttingedge information on objectoriented topics. By describing practical stories, explaining the design and programming process in detail, and using projects as a learning context, the text helps readers understand why a given technique is required and why techniques must be combined to overcome the challenges. Written by experts in their respective areas, these clear and concise papers are the fastest way to get the latest findings by todays top oo professionals. Software engineering architectural design geeksforgeeks. The only improvement we did, is that we sometimes wanted to avoid going through all versions, since it was a lengthly process, so you could define migrations from any version to any version if you are in version 1. Let us assume there is a requirement of a onefloor building where in the future we can add some more floors, and also we will be able to change the room design of new or existing floors with easytomake partitions at any time. This means that all examinees that in the age range for the form will be sent to the export file. Automotive, furniture, upholstery, footwear and garment industry. Mar 07, 2017 the origins of software design patterns the groundbreaking book design patterns.
The pabre framework is designed to support requirement reuse through the use. While installing a new psychcorpcenter assessment software does not delete. Using patterns and agile development guides students through the software development process. It is a description or template for how to solve a problem, that can be used in different situations. Pattern grading software and fashion drafting marker maker. A design pattern typically shows relationship and interaction between classes or objects, without specifying final application classes or objects that are.
Compared to the use of threads and locks, this is a highlevel programming model. Ieee defines architectural design as the process of defining a collection of hardware and software components and their interfaces to establish the framework for the development of a computer system. See more ideas about drafting software, pattern cutting, pattern. Pearson assessment support dasii scoring assistant. Software requirement reuse strategies are necessary to capitalize and reuse knowledge in the requirements engineering phase. Design pattern for software updates stack overflow. So a definition which more closely reflects its use within the patterns community is. Pdf investigating the theoretical structure of the differential ability. Mostly simply put, its a solution to a commonly occurring problem. The architectural patterns address various issues in software engineering, such as computer hardware performance limitations, high availability and minimization of a business risk. Objects, design and concurrency design patterns jonathan aldrich charlie garrod 15214. The subtests are organized in two batteries that are based on age. Using profile analysis, you can identify the childs strengths and weaknesses so the appropriate iep goals, intervention strategies, and progress monitoring can be developed. Differential ability scales second edition dasii psychology.
Universal easytouse cad system used mainly in the leather and textile. Telestia creator pattern grading cad software introduces a unique system of grading patterns, that has simplified this process for you in a miraculous way by removing all the hard work yet leaving you in control. Join pattern provides a way to write concurrent, parallel and distributed programs by message passing. All of our programs are sold separately and do not require other software to function. Its possible to update the information on pattern design system or report it as discontinued, duplicated or spam. Each pattern explains what a requirement needs to convey, offers potential questions to ask, points out potential pitfalls, suggests extra requirements, and other advice. Show a class diagram for representing packages, complete with inheritance relations and method signatures. Software dps the design pattern bible junit case study gof catalog 16. Collection, patternmaker pattern viewer, or patternmaker deluxe editor 2.
Prices and availability are subject to change without notice. This language comprises the names of recognizable patterns and their elements. The dasii scoring assistant export allows you to export all records for a particular form. Dasii scores can be used as part of the crossbattery assessment software system. The software needs the architectural design to represents the design of software. At school age, the dasii contains six core subtests that combine to yield three firstorder. Software design patterns classification and selection using. The software needs to track the contents of a box e. A software design pattern is a general solution to a common problem in software design. Pdf when the differential ability scalessecond edition dasii was developed. The differential ability scales second edition dasii continues the tradition of providing an indepth analysis of childrens learning abilities. Please note that the software is compatible with windows xp, windows vista, windows 7, 8 and 10.